What does a room addition cost in Los Angeles? It is one of the most common questions homeowners ask before deciding whether to build or buy. In 2026, room addition costs in Greater LA range from $80,000 for a basic bedroom addition to $450,000+ for a full second story addition. This guide breaks down every cost category so you can plan your budget accurately. Room Addition Costs by Type — Los Angeles 2026

Bedroom Addition Cost — $80,000 to $165,000

A single bedroom addition (200–400 sq ft) is the most straightforward addition type. It adds a room to an existing level of the house, typically with a closet, and may or may not include a bathroom.

Primary Suite Addition Cost — $125,000 to $240,000

A primary suite addition includes a bedroom plus a dedicated bathroom. This is the most popular addition type in Los Angeles, as many older homes lack a proper primary suite.

Family Room / Great Room Addition Cost — $110,000 to $210,000

A family room or great room addition (400–600 sq ft) typically opens to the existing kitchen or living area. Often involves removing a wall and adding a beam to connect the addition to the existing space.

Second Story Addition Cost — $220,000 to $450,000+

A full second story addition (full floor, typically 1,000–1,800 sq ft) transforms a single-story home into a two-story home. It is the most complex type of addition and often involves significant structural reinforcement of the existing first floor, plus a staircase, new roof, and complete MEP for the upper floor.

Frequently Asked Questions — Room Addition Cost Los Angeles

How much does a bedroom addition cost in Los Angeles in 2026?

A bedroom addition (200–400 sq ft) in Los Angeles costs $80,000–$165,000 in 2026, including foundation, framing, MEP rough-in, interior finishes, and permits. Adding a bathroom to the bedroom pushes the cost to a primary suite range of $125,000–$240,000.

How much does a second story addition cost in Los Angeles?

A full second story addition in Los Angeles costs $220,000–$450,000+. The wide range reflects variation in size (1,000–1,800 sq ft), structural complexity (some first floors require significant reinforcement), finish level, and permit jurisdiction. Second story additions in cities with their own building departments (Santa Monica, Pasadena) may have higher permit costs.

How long does a room addition take in Los Angeles?

A bedroom or primary suite addition in Los Angeles takes 10–16 months total: 4–6 weeks for design and engineering, 5–10 weeks for permit processing (LADBS or applicable city), and 14–24 weeks for construction. A second story addition takes 14–22 months total due to the larger construction scope.

Do I need permits for a room addition in Los Angeles?

Yes. All room additions in Los Angeles require building permits. Structural work requires stamped engineering calculations.
